D-Wave Shares Jump to New High After Reported Police Response Gains From Hybrid-Quantum Tool

Investors reacted to announcements that North Wales Police reported a 50% response boost using the technology.

Overview

  • D-Wave Quantum closed up 13.97% at $29.21 after touching a 52-week high of $29.61 during Thursday trading.
  • Company and partner announcements said a hybrid-quantum application improved North Wales Police response capability by 50%.
  • The application was described as optimizing police vehicle placement for emergencies and outperforming classical methods on speed and accuracy.
  • CEO Alan Baratz said hybrid-quantum computing can deliver the precision needed for officer deployment and is showing real-world potential across sectors.
